taglinefilesource code
newprot214arch/sparc/mm/srmmu.cstatic pte_t srmmu_pte_modify(pte_t pte, pgprot_t newprot)
newprot215arch/sparc/mm/srmmu.c{ pte_val(pte) = (pte_val(pte) & ~0xff) | pgprot_val(newprot); return pte; }
newprot1368arch/sparc/mm/sun4c.cstatic pte_t sun4c_pte_modify(pte_t pte, pgprot_t newprot)
newprot1370arch/sparc/mm/sun4c.creturn __pte((pte_val(pte) & _SUN4C_PAGE_CHG_MASK) | pgprot_val(newprot));
newprot278include/asm-alpha/pgtable.hextern inline pte_t pte_modify(pte_t pte, pgprot_t newprot)
newprot279include/asm-alpha/pgtable.h{ pte_val(pte) = (pte_val(pte) & _PAGE_CHG_MASK) | pgprot_val(newprot); return pte; }
newprot343include/asm-i386/pgtable.hextern inline pte_t pte_modify(pte_t pte, pgprot_t newprot)
newprot344include/asm-i386/pgtable.h{ pte_val(pte) = (pte_val(pte) & _PAGE_CHG_MASK) | pgprot_val(newprot); return pte; }
newprot190include/asm-m68k/pgtable.hextern inline pte_t pte_modify(pte_t pte, pgprot_t newprot)
newprot191include/asm-m68k/pgtable.h{ pte_val(pte) = (pte_val(pte) & _PAGE_CHG_MASK) | pgprot_val(newprot); return pte; }
newprot340include/asm-mips/pgtable.hextern inline pte_t pte_modify(pte_t pte, pgprot_t newprot)
newprot341include/asm-mips/pgtable.h{ pte_val(pte) = (pte_val(pte) & _PAGE_CHG_MASK) | pgprot_val(newprot); return pte; }
newprot274include/asm-ppc/pgtable.hextern inline pte_t pte_modify(pte_t pte, pgprot_t newprot)
newprot275include/asm-ppc/pgtable.h{ pte_val(pte) = (pte_val(pte) & _PAGE_CHG_MASK) | pgprot_val(newprot); return pte; }
newprot99include/linux/mm.hvoid (*protect)(struct vm_area_struct *area, unsigned long, size_t, unsigned int newprot);
newprot21mm/mprotect.cunsigned long size, pgprot_t newprot)
newprot41mm/mprotect.cset_pte(pte, pte_modify(entry, newprot));
newprot48mm/mprotect.cunsigned long size, pgprot_t newprot)
newprot66mm/mprotect.cchange_pte_range(pmd, address, end - address, newprot);
newprot72mm/mprotect.cstatic void change_protection(unsigned long start, unsigned long end, pgprot_t newprot)
newprot80mm/mprotect.cchange_pmd_range(dir, start, end - start, newprot);
newprot180mm/mprotect.cpgprot_t newprot;
newprot185mm/mprotect.cnewprot = protection_map[newflags & 0xf];
newprot188mm/mprotect.cerror = mprotect_fixup_all(vma, newflags, newprot);
newprot190mm/mprotect.cerror = mprotect_fixup_start(vma, end, newflags, newprot);
newprot192mm/mprotect.cerror = mprotect_fixup_end(vma, start, newflags, newprot);
newprot194mm/mprotect.cerror = mprotect_fixup_middle(vma, start, end, newflags, newprot);
newprot199mm/mprotect.cchange_protection(start, end, newprot);